xzh2000的博客 本人提供杭州地区Oracle现场技术支持服务,包括性能调整、DataGuard、RAC等。
16 11, 2006
10g关闭对象统计信息收集
作者 xzh2000 13:55 | Permalink 静态链接网址 | Comments 最新回复 (2) | Trackback 引用 (0) | 技术交流

10g中通过scheduler自动收集对象(表与索引)的统计信息,有两种办法可以关闭对象统计信息的收集,虽然不建议关闭对象统计信息的分析,如果一定要关闭对象统计信息的收集,有两种办法可以参考,具体办法如下:


关闭与激活对象统计信息的分析的方法
1
exec dbms_scheduler.disable('SYS.GATHER_STATS_JOB');
exec dbms_scheduler.enable('SYS.GATHER_STATS_JOB');
2
alter system set "_optimizer_autostats_job"=false scope=spfile;
alter system set "_optimizer_autostats_job"=true scope=spfile;

SQL 10G> set pages 9999
SQL 10G> set lines 121
SQL 10G> col ksppinm format a36
SQL 10G> col ksppstvl format a18
SQL 10G> col ksppdesc format a54
SQL 10G> select ksppinm, ksppstvl, ksppdesc
2 from x$ksppi pi, x$ksppcv cv
3 where cv.indx=pi.indx and pi.ksppinm like '_%' escape ''
4 and pi.ksppinm like '%&parameter%';
Enter value for parameter: _optimizer_autostats_job
old 4: and pi.ksppinm like '%&parameter%'
new 4: and pi.ksppinm like '%_optimizer_autostats_job%'
KSPPINM KSPPSTVL KSPPDESC
------------------------ ----- ------------------------
_optimizer_autostats_job TRUE enable/disable auto stats collection job

Comments

完全没有必要啦...

作者 xzh 18 11 2006, 21:50

有了自动收集对象的统计信息,我们还有必要手动写脚步收集吗?

作者 leeecho 18 11 2006, 17:36
博客日历
« 三月 2010 »
1 2 3 4 5 6 7
8 9 10 11 12 13 14
15 16 17 18 19 20 21
22 23 24 25 26 27 28
29 30 31        
搜索
最新发表
文章分类
文章归档
网站链接
新闻聚合